I had the pleasure of meeting some wonderful people while I was in Jamaica. I went to this small village called Green Island, It was about a 15 minute drive from Negril. I piled into a local taxi with about 6 people and we blew the speed limit open while Vybz Kartel beat in the back. I spent hours with Rastas talking about conspiracy theories, good music and string theory. Every good point was followed by drinking some clear sort of liquor and some red type of liquor. I also went to the best Rasta Fish spot. I had Conch with vegetables and It literally was the best meal I’ve ever had.
